Anaheim

Image by James Hartono

Located in the center of Orange County between Los Angeles and San Diego is the city most famous for its theme parks - Anaheim. Walt Disney bought 160 acres of citrus groves and built Disneyland, which is now much larger encompassing Disney Resort, Disney California Adventure, Downtown Disney and three hotels. 

​

Downtown Anaheim has recently been revitalized and now boasts new shops, restaurants, craft breweries and multiple entertainment and sports venues. It has become an epicenter for farmers markets, art crawls and festivals. A community that thrives on tourism - Anaheim has become a community gathering place for renovations, live music, art galleries and museums.

LOS ANGELES

Home to Hollywood stars and movie studios, Los Angeles is the most populous city in all of California. Known as the capital of entertainment and film, LA is also known for its many beaches, renowned nightlife and great culinary scene. Whether it's Hollywood, Beverly Hills, Santa Monica or Malibu, the city is packed with many things to see and do!

Top 10 Things to Do in Los Angeles

1. Walk among the engraved stars along the Hollywood Walk of Fame

2. Hike to the Hollywood Sign

3. Visit the Griffith Observatory and overlook the city's backdrop

4. Shop and dine along the two-mile long Rodeo Drive

5. Enjoy a day in the sun at the Santa Monica Pier

6. Catch a pickup game or stroll the boardwalk of Venice Beach

7. Catch a comedy show along Sunset Boulevard

8. Enjoy scenic and bird's eye views from Mulholland Drive

9. Attend a LA Lakers, Dodgers or Kings professional game

10. Tour behind-the-scenes of Universal Studios or Warner Bros. Studios

Perched on a hilly peninsula overlooking the bay waters sits San Francisco. The core of the Bay Area, it is known for its charming culture and architecture. The city plays host to an array of museums, galleries, artistic venues and events as the art scene reigns here.

​

Tourists flock to Fisherman's Wharf to embark on its famous boat tours around the bay and Alcatraz. The city boasts the largest Chinatown outside of Asia with its plethora of authentic Chinese cuisine with Little Italy closely located next door. 

 

Head north to wine country, east to Oakland or stay local and explore the Golden Gate district's chic neighborhoods, historic fishing marinas, and fantastic views on a stroll across the Golden Gate Bridge.

San Diego

About 120 miles south of LA sits California's second largest city, San Diego. A favorite tourist destination among travelers, it boasts a sprawling landscape of suburbs, a bustling downtown district and plenty of beaches. It also makes for a great getaway for children:

​

  • Family Friendly

  • Home to Sea World

  • The famous San Diego Zoo

  • LEGOLAND

  • Balboa Park

​

A vibrant city with many restaurants and shopping districts, embark on a journey to the Gaslamp Quarter or enjoy a day on the waterfront at Mission, La Jolla or Pacific Beach. San Diego is home to many water sports such as kayaking, surfing, and sailing.

 

San Diego is a great place to discover more of Southern California beyond LA and Orange County with its many family-friendly attractions, historical landmarks and Mediterranean-like climate!
